Abstract

This study aims to examine how the profitability of commercial banks listed on the Indonesia Stock Exchange (IDX) during the 2020–2024 period is influenced by Capital Adequacy Ratio (CAR), Loan to Deposit Ratio (LDR), and Non-Performing Loans (NPL). The importance of profitability as an indicator of bank soundness in managing economic risks, particularly following financial credit relaxation policies, serves as the background of this research. Financial ratio theory and banking management are employed to assess operational effectiveness. Using purposive sampling combined with a descriptive quantitative research approach, this study selected six banks as samples with a total of thirty observations. Secondary data were collected through documentation and literature review from official annual financial reports. The data were analyzed using multiple linear regression and classical assumption tests with SPSS software. The results show that CAR, LDR, and NPL simultaneously have a significant effect on Return on Assets (ROA). Partially, CAR has a positive and significant effect on ROA, while NPL has a significant negative effect. In contrast, LDR does not have a significant effect on profitability in this model. The Adjusted R Square value of 0.695 indicates that the independent variables explain 69.5% of the variation in profitability. Strengthening capital and controlling non-performing loans are essential to maintaining bank financial performance.
